potential energy
Potential energy is the stored energy in an object due to its position, arrangement, or state, such as height, stress, or electric charge
kinetic energy
Kinetic energy is the energy an object possesses due to its motion
elastic energy
Elastic energy is the mechanical potential energy stored in an elastic object when it is deformed, such as being stretched, compressed, or bent
chemical potential energy
Chemical potential energy is the energy stored within the chemical bonds of a substance
gravitational potential energy
Gravitational potential energy (GPE) is the energy an object has due to its position in a gravitational field
mechanical energy
Mechanical energy is the total energy of an object due to its motion (kinetic energy) and its position (potential energy)
